Wallin Education Partners grant funding provided to support college admission and graduation programming for low-income students, report required, and money appropriated.
HF 2417 appropriates $500,000 for fiscal year 2026 and $500,000 for 2027 to Wallin Education Partners to support college admission and graduation services for low-income Minnesota students attending Minnesota colleges. The funding covers financial aid guidance, academic advising, and career development programming. Wallin must use the funds only for Minnesota residents enrolled at Minnesota institutions and submit annual reports by February 1st detailing student demographics, schools served, and geographic distribution. This bill directly affects low-income students in Minnesota and requires transparency through mandated reporting.
